Product Information

The Nano-CaptureLigand mouse IgG2b captures and immobilizes mouse IgG2b antibodies and Fc-fragments to avidin/streptavidin coated surfaces used in BLI, SPR, and ELISA assays. It consists of a biotinylated Nanobody that specifically binds to mouse IgG2b antibodies with high affinity and in a site-directed manner.

DescriptionThe next level of antibody immobilization to BLI and SPR biosensors:

• Gentle, site-directed and Fc-specific immobilization of mouse IgG2b antibodies and Fc-fragments to streptavidin coated biosensors without biotinylation of the antibody

• Compatible to surface plasmon resonance (SPR) and biolayer interferometry (BLI) assays (e.g. FortéBio Octet® systems)

• High affinity for stable baseline without significant dissociation

• >10x regeneration for multiple reuse

• High specificity enables mouse IgG2b antibody discovery and screening in crude liquids like hybridoma supernatant, serum, and plasma samples

ReactivityFc-fragment of mouse IgG2b
No cross-reactivity to mouse IgG1, Ig2a, Ig2c, IgG3; human IgG1, IgG2, IgG3, IgG4, IgA; rat IgG1, IgG2a, IgG2b; sera from goat, human, macaque (cynomolgus monkey), sheep

Affinity (KD) KD= 0.2 nM
Apparent affinity may be higher for full IgGs due to avidity effects (1 antibody captured by 2 Nanobodies).
